Green Ridge took a 15-run loss the last time they faced off against Northwest, but this time they managed to keep it close and that made all the difference. The Tigers came out on top in a nail-biter against the Mustangs on Saturday, sneaking past 4-2. The victory was familiar territory for the Tigers, who have now won four games in a row.
Green Ridge's win was their first in the district, bumping their district record up to 1-2 and their overall record up to 6-4. As for Northwest, their defeat dropped their record down to 11-2.
Green Ridge has already played their next match, a 10-0 loss against Lincoln on the 12th. Northwest has also already played their next contest (against Wellington-Napoleon), but no score has been uploaded at the time of writing.
